

Totally Killer

When the infamous "Sweet Sixteen Killer" returns 35 years after his first murder spree to claim another victim, 17-year-old Jamie accidentally travels back in time to 1987, determined to stop the killer before he can start.

Back to the Future meets Scream in this comedy, sci-fi, slasher about a teenage girl who travels back in time to stop a serial killer that has been terrorizing her parents' friend group since they were in high school. It is absolutely hilarious to see a gen Z-er navigate the 80s and to see a visual representation of the Mandela effect in real time. It wasn't perfect, but damn was it fun.
